/*
Theme Name: Burntgate1
Theme URI: http://www.relevantsystems.co.uk
Description: Burnt Gate Theme
Version: 1.0
Author: Mike Willis
Author URI: http://www.relevantsystems.co.uk
*/
body, h1, h2, h3, h4, h5, h6, address, blockquote, dd, dl, hr, p, form{
margin: 0;
padding: 0;
}
body{
font-family: verdana, arial, helvetica, sans-serif;
font-size: 14px;
text-align: center;
vertical-align: top;
background: #ededed;
color: #000;
}
#content ul{
margin: 5px 0 0 5px;
}
table{
font-family: verdana, arial, helvetica, sans-serif;
font-size: 12px;
}
h1, h2, h3, h4, h5, h6{
font-family: arial, helvetica, sans-serif;
font-size: 16px;
font-weight: bold;
color: #6D3225;
}
a{
text-decoration: underline;
color: #8f3939;
}
a:hover{text-decoration: none;}
a img{border: 0;}
p{padding: 10px 0 5px;}
blockquote{
margin: 10px 0 0;
border-top: 2px solid #ddd;
background: #f5f5f5;
}
blockquote p{padding: 10px;}
blockquote blockquote{
float:none;
width: auto;
margin: 0 10px;
background: #fff;
}
dd{
padding: 0 0 0 20px;
}
form, input, textarea{
font-family: verdana, arial, helvetica, sans-serif;
font-size: 12px;
}
p img{
max-width: 100%;
}
img.centered{
display:block;
margin-left: auto;
margin-right: auto;
}
img.alignright{
margin: 3px 0 2px 10px;
padding: 4px;
border: 1px solid #ededed;
display: inline;
}
img.alignleft{
margin: 3px 10px 2px 0;
padding: 4px;
border: 1px solid #ededed;
display: inline;
}
.alignleft{float: left;}
.alignright{float: right;}
.clear{margin: 0; padding: 0; clear:both;}
small{
font-size: 11px;
}
#wrapper{
width: 980px;
margin: 0 auto;
border: 3px solid #dff1d7;
text-align: left;
}
#header{
float: left;
width: 730px;
height: 120px;
background: #fff url(images/burnt-gate-header.png);
background-repeat:no-repeat;
}
#headerright{
float: left;
width: 250px;
height: 120px;
background: url(images/burnt-gate-exterior.jpg);
background-repeat:no-repeat;
}
#header h1{
width: 730px;
height: 120px;
}
#header h1 a{
display: none;
}
#headerright h1 a{
display: none;
}
#menu{
float: left;
width: 980px;
border-top: 1px solid #ededed;
background: #dff1d7;
}
#menu ul{
list-style: none;
margin: 0;
padding: 0;
}
#menu ul li{
float: left;
}
#menu ul li a{
display: block;
padding: 10px;
border-right: 1px solid #ededed;
text-decoration: none;
color: #6D3225;
}
#menu ul li a:hover{
background: #c7e5b8;
}
#about{
float: left;
width: 980px;
border-top: 1px solid #dff1d7;
border-bottom: 1px solid #dff1d7;
padding: 0 0 14px 0;
text-align: right;
font-family: Book-Antigua, "Times New Roman", Times, serif;
font-size: 20px;
font-style: italic;
letter-spacing: 2pt;
line-height: 30px;
background: #c7e5b8;
color: #fff;
}
#about p{
padding: 10px 10px 0 0;
}
#about #aboutstrip{
float: left;
width: 780px;
background: #c7e5b8;
}
#container{
float: left;
width: 980px;
border-top: 2px solid #000;
background: #fff;
}
#content{
float: left;
width: 724px;
padding: 0 0 10px 0;
}
#pagemenu{
width: 650px;
margin: 20px 0 20px 0;
padding: 10px;
text-align: center;
border: 1px solid #c7e5b8;
}
.sidebar{
float: right;
width: 250px;
margin: 0 5px 0 1px;
background: #fff;
}
.navigation{
margin: 10px 0 10px 0;
border-top: 1px solid #dff1d7;
padding: 5px 10px 6px;
background: #fdfbe7 url(images/bg_navigation.gif) repeat-x left bottom;
line-height: 24px;
}
.post{
padding: 10px 20px;
}
.post h2{
font-size: 24px;
font-weight: normal;
}
.post ht a{
color: #000;
}
.entry-date{
padding: 10px 10px 0 10px;
color: #666;
}
.entry-content{
line-height: 24px;
}
.entry-content h2, .entry-content h3, .entry-content h4, .entry-content h5{
padding: 10px 0 5px;
}
.entry-content h2 a{
color: #8f3939;
}
.entry-content h3{
font-size: 18px;
font-weight:normal;
}
.entry-content h5{
font-size: 14px;
}
.entry-content h6{
font-size: 12px;
}
.entry-meta{
padding: 10px 0 0 0;
line-height: 24px;
}
.sidebar ul{
list-style: none;
margin: 0;
padding: 0;
}
.sidebar ul{
margin: 0 0 10px;
}
.sidebar ul li{
padding: 0 0 10px 0;
}
.sidebar ul li h2{
border-top: 1px solid #dfdfdf;
padding: 8px 10px 9px;
font-family: Georgia, Arial, Helvetica;
font-size: 16px;
font-weight: bold;
background: #fffaad url(images/bg_sidebar_h2.gif) repeat-x left bottom;
}
.sidebar ul ul{
margin: 0;
padding: 6px 10px 0;
line-height: 24px;
}
.sidebar ul ul li{
padding: 0;
}
.sidebar ul ul ul{
padding: 0 0 0 10px;
}
#footer{
float: left;
width: 980px;
padding: 3px 0 3px 0;
border-top: 2px solid #000;
text-align: center;
line-height: 18px;
font-family: Verdana, Arial, Sans-serif;
font-size: 10px;
background: #c7e5b8;
}
#footer ul li{
display: inline;
list-style: none;
margin: 0;
padding: 0;
}